不及物動詞 ( rang; rung; ringing )
按鈴;搖鈴;敲鐘
(鐘、鈴等)鳴,響
I was making the bed when the telephone rang. 我在鋪床時電話鈴響了。
主英打電話
回響;響徹
My husband's last words are still ringing in my ears. 丈夫的臨終遺言還在我耳邊回響。
響個不停,壹再響起
聽上去,聽起來
Her promise rang hollow. 她的許諾聽上去像是空話。
及物動詞 ( rang; rung; ringing )
按(鈴);搖(鈴);敲(鐘)
She felt bad and rang the bedside bell for a nurse. 她覺得身體不適,按了床邊的鈴叫護士來。
主英打電話給
Your wife has rung you twice since lunch time. 午飯後妳太太已給妳來過兩次電話了。
I'll ring you up as soon as they arrive. 他們壹到我就給妳打電話。
發(鳴響);以鐘聲宣告;鐘聲報(時)
名詞 ( pl. rings )
鈴聲,鐘聲;按鈴,敲鐘
There was a ring of laughter in the corridor. 走廊裏傳來響亮的笑聲。
語氣;口氣
His remarks had a ring of sincerity. 他的話語氣真誠。
主英口打電話
ring [美] [r?] [英] [ri?]
名詞 ( pl. rings )
圈;環;環形物
Fatigue brought on dark rings under her eyes. 勞累使她眼睛下部出現了黑圈。
戒指;耳環
年輪;圍成壹圈的人(或物)
I watched the children dancing in a ring. 我看著孩子們圍成壹圈跳舞。
圓形竈盤
馬戲場;拳擊場
(不法)集團,幫派
及物動詞 ( ringed; ringed; ringing )
包圍;圍住
The rebellious troops ringed the airfield. 叛軍包圍了機場。
使成環形
不及物動詞 ( ringed; ringed; ringing )
成環形
